via Scoble, here is some discussion of Ballmer’s comments on music piracy. Clearly, the general point has nothing to do with iPod, but simply asserts that the majority of music in people’s personal collections is pirated. I think this is a safe bet.
Most people in my age brackethave huge CD collections, and have ripped these to their iPods, so likely are more than half legal. Andpeoplemy agebuy a lot through iTunes music store (I spend roughly $100/month at iTunes store, mostly on audio books; and iTunes sales numbers are public knowledge). But I also remember what it was like to be in college and high school, and I think that this demographic are much more ravenous consumers of music and much more price sensitive. I think it is very safe to say that the bulk of music out there (especially the music that gets played frequently, versus some old dusty CD that was ripped and never played) is pirated.
